The Nitty-Gritty: Exam Format and Fun Facts (Because Seriously, Facts Can Be Fun)

  • The Two-Headed Beast: You'll be facing a two-part exam, a national section with 80 questions and a state-specific section with 40 questions.
  • Passing the Grade: To conquer this beast, you'll need a 70% or higher on both sections. No cherry-picking here!
  • Time Crunch? Don't worry, you've got four hours to slay this exam dragon. That's plenty of time, as long as you don't get too distracted by daydreaming about that corner office with the view of a million-dollar mansion (we've all been there).

The Difficulty Dilemma: Separating Myth from Mayhem

Alright, alright, we know what you're really here for. Is this exam going to leave you feeling like you just ran a marathon blindfolded? Here's the deal:

  • It's a Challenge, Not a Death Sentence: The exam covers a lot of ground, from legalities and contracts to financing and fair housing. It's designed to ensure you have the knowledge to navigate the exciting (and sometimes crazy) world of real estate. But with proper preparation, you can be well-equipped to tackle it.
  • Pass Rates Got You Sweating? Don't panic! Pass rates for the Ohio Real Estate Exam hover around 50%-80%, depending on who you ask. That means with dedication and hard work, you can absolutely join the winning team.

Can I Take the Exam Online?

Nope, the Ohio Real Estate Exam must be taken in person at a designated testing center.
